AN amateur photographer with autism is showing off some of his new pictures at Spinning Gate Shopping Centre in Leigh this week.

Paul Heaton, who works as a factory assistant for Belmont Packaging in Hindley Green, travels across the UK to snap pictures of wildlife, trains and charity events.

The 59-year-old's talent with a camera has featured on TV as well as train and wildlife magazines over the years.

Paul's photographs of wildlife and trains have been on display at the centre from yesterday, Monday and will be there until Friday.

His colleague at Belmont Packaging, e-commerce team leader Kelly Rowson, said: "We are really proud of Paul.

"He always brings his photographs into work and we like it when he does."

Paul's work was also on display at The Galleries shopping centre in Wigan last year where several of his pictures - including his famous red robin picture which has starred on TV - featured.

Away from photography, Paul enjoys line dancing and hosted a class last year to share his moves.
